Notably, a total of 42% of the applicants to Pine Technical & Community College receive the Federal Grant every year. On the other hand, 60% of the candidates get the Student Grant, while 42% receive the Pell Grant. And, for the Pell Grant awardees, the average aid amount is $3,543. Among other things, the annual family income of the applicant plays a major role in determining the total financial aid they are actually eligible to receive. Apart from financial grants and scholarships, candidates can also avail of monetary benefits like student loans to fund their education. In contrast to grants and scholarships, student loans are taken by the candidates at a certain rate of interest. While grants and scholarship schemes do not require repayment, student loans should be repaid by the applicants within a given period. At PTCC, an estimated number of 25% of the applicants choose to go for student loans.
